The Albert Einstein Academy for Letters, Arts and Sciences is set to open in August 2010 with 225 students in grades seven through ninth, with future expansion to include grades tenth-twelfth and kindergarten through six.
The school will prepare its students for rigorous college studies through exceptional foreign language programs, outstanding academics, and rich extracurricular activities. Its innovative interdisciplinary programs will instill within its graduates a global perspective.
Based on a pressing community need as described by local parents and community leadership, the Einstein Academy will prepare students for both knowledge-based careers and lives as members of a democratic society through classwork that emphasizes global awareness and continual enrollment in foreign language classes. Each student will graduate from the Academy having completed a minimum of four years of language studies during middle & high school (grades 7 through 12).
